How much do child development j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 23, 2026, the average hourly pay for child development in Springfield, MO is $17.50,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.72 and $18.80 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Child Development job?

A Child Development job involves working with children to support their physical, emotional, social, and cognitive growth. Professionals in this field may work as teachers, childcare providers, social workers, or developmental specialists. They observe and assess children's progress, develop age-appropriate activities, and provide guidance to families. These jobs often require knowledge of child psychology, education, and developmental milestones.

What is the highest paying job in child development?

The highest paying jobs in child development typically include pediatric healthcare professionals such as pediatric surgeons, pediatric anesthesiologists, and child psychiatrists, who require advanced medical degrees and specialized training. Administrative roles like director of a child development center or clinical director can also offer high salaries, especially with extensive experience and certifications. These positions often involve leadership responsibilities and require advanced education and licensure.

What degree does a child development specialist need?

A child development specialist typically needs at least a bachelor's degree in child development, early childhood education, psychology, or a related field. Some positions may require a master's degree or additional certifications, such as the Child Development Associate (CDA) credential, to advance in the field.

What does a typical day look like for professionals working in Child Development?

A typical day for Child Development professionals involves planning and implementing age-appropriate educational activities, observing and tracking each child's progress, and maintaining a safe, supportive environment. They frequently collaborate with parents, teachers, and other specialists to address individual developmental needs and create tailored strategies for growth. Daily responsibilities may include documenting observations, conducting developmental screenings, and attending team meetings to discuss child progress. The variety in daily tasks helps maintain an engaging work environment and directly contributes to the positive development and well-being of children.

Job Description:

A Lead Teacher is responsible for maintaining a safe and healthy learning environment, to promote the positive development of all children. Plans, directs and coordinates the academic and nonacademic activities of the children in our care. Carry out learning objectives for all ages of children in their care/classroom. Greets parents and children at drop off/pick up. Ensures that all daily tasks are completed correctly and in a timely manner, such as diapers/potty training, laundry, cleaning tables, chairs, diapering/toileting areas before and after each use, clean toys at naptime and/or end of each shift, and stocks supplies for the next day. Knows and complies with keeping state mandated child/staff ratios at all times and all other state, federal and Accreditation regulations/standards.

Education
Required: A minimum of 9 College hours related to early childhood OR Minimum of 6 college hours at an accredited college or university and MOA Educational Wavier obtained upon hire.OR Current CDA credential (Child Development Associate Credential)
Experience
Preferred: 1-2 Years Related Experience
Skills
Excellent customer service skills.
Excellent time management, interpersonal, communication, organization, prioritizing, decision-making and planning skills.
Able to perform in highly stressful situations, including high volume times such as morning drop off times and during overlap (start of 2nd shift) drop off/afternoon pickup times.
Health Screening required.
Successful annual clearance from Family Care Safety Registry.
An annual TB test required.
At least 18 years of age.
Initital T-Dap immune
Licensure/Certification/Registration
Required: Must obtain Heartsaver Pediatric CPR/FA/AED certification within 30 days of hire
